What Is Maximum Heart Rate?
Your maximum heart rate (HRmax) is the highest number of times your heart can beat in a minute during maximal effort. It matters because it is the reference point for exercise intensity: heart rate zones — and the moderate and vigorous ranges guidelines recommend — are all defined as a percentage of it.
Maximum heart rate is determined largely by your age and genetics, and it declines gradually as you get older. It is not a sign of fitness — a fit person and an unfit person of the same age tend to have a similar maximum. What fitness changes is your resting heart rate, how much blood your heart pumps per beat, and how comfortably you can work at a high percentage of your maximum.

Maximum Heart Rate by Age
Estimated maximum heart rate for ages 20 to 70, both formulas side by side. The row matching the calculator above is highlighted.
| Age | 220 − age | 208 − 0.7 × age |
|---|---|---|
| 20 years | 200 bpm | 194 bpm |
| 25 years | 195 bpm | 190 bpm |
| 30 years | 190 bpm | 187 bpm |
| 35 years | 185 bpm | 184 bpm |
| 40 years | 180 bpm | 180 bpm |
| 45 years | 175 bpm | 176 bpm |
| 50 years | 170 bpm | 173 bpm |
| 55 years | 165 bpm | 170 bpm |
| 60 years | 160 bpm | 166 bpm |
| 65 years | 155 bpm | 162 bpm |
| 70 years | 150 bpm | 159 bpm |
Estimates only; a healthy person’s true maximum can sit above or below these figures.
220 − Age vs the Tanaka Formula
The 220 − age formula is easy to remember and fine as a rough guide, but it was never meant to be precise — it can be off by around 10 to 12 beats per minute for any individual, and it tends to overestimate maximum heart rate in younger people and underestimate it in older people.
A large analysis proposed a more accurate estimate, 208 − (0.7 × age), published as “Age-predicted maximal heart rate revisited” in the Journal of the American College of Cardiology (2001). The two formulas agree at around age 40 and diverge either side of it — which is why the chart above shows both. For everyday training either is close enough; the honest answer is that any formula is an estimate.
How Maximum Heart Rate Is Measured
A formula estimates it; only a test measures it.

Formula estimate
The quickest approach — 220 − age, or the Tanaka formula. Good enough to set training zones for general fitness, but an average rather than your personal number.

A supervised exercise test
The accurate way is a graded maximal exercise test — the intensity is raised in stages while your heart is monitored until you reach your true maximum. A treadmill stress test is done in a similar way and, importantly, also checks how your heart behaves under load, not just how fast it goes.

Field tests & monitors
Trained athletes sometimes estimate maximum from an all-out effort recorded on a chest-strap monitor. This is only for healthy, experienced exercisers — pushing to a true maximum is not something to attempt if you are unfit or have any heart concern.
What Affects Your Maximum Heart Rate
Age is by far the biggest factor — maximum heart rate falls by roughly one beat per minute per year. Genetics explain much of the person-to-person difference at any given age. Fitness does not raise it; if anything, very well-trained endurance athletes can have a slightly lower maximum. Some medicines, especially beta-blockers and certain calcium-channel blockers, lower it, so the age formula will read too high if you take them.
Stop and seek medical help if you feel chest pain or pressure, unusual breathlessness, dizziness, or a fast or irregular heartbeat during hard exercise — see when to see a cardiologist. If your heart rate readings seem far from the estimate, or your heart races or skips at rest, that is worth having checked rather than explained away by the formula.

Maximum Heart Rate: FAQ
Answers to common questions about calculating and interpreting your maximum heart rate.
How do I calculate my maximum heart rate?
The simplest estimate is 220 minus your age in years. For example, a 40-year-old has an estimated maximum heart rate of about 180 bpm. A formula shown to be more accurate across ages is 208 minus 0.7 times your age, which also gives about 180 bpm at age 40 and diverges from the 220-minus-age figure at younger and older ages. The calculator on this page works out both for you. Both are estimates — individuals vary.
Is 220 minus age accurate?
It is a convenient rule of thumb, but it is only an average and can be off by around 10 to 12 beats per minute for any individual. Research has found it tends to overestimate maximum heart rate in younger people and underestimate it in older people, which is why the formula 208 minus 0.7 times age was proposed as more accurate. For a precise figure, a supervised maximal exercise test is needed.
What is a normal maximum heart rate by age?
Using 220 minus age, a rough guide is about 200 bpm at age 20, 190 at 30, 180 at 40, 170 at 50, 160 at 60 and 150 at 70. These are population averages — a healthy person’s true maximum can sit above or below the estimate for their age.
Does maximum heart rate decrease with age?
Yes. Maximum heart rate falls gradually as you get older, by roughly one beat per minute per year on average. This is a normal part of ageing and happens whether or not you are fit — it is why heart-rate training zones, which are a percentage of maximum, shift lower with age.
Can I increase my maximum heart rate with training?
Not meaningfully. Maximum heart rate is set mostly by your age and genetics, and regular training does not raise it. What fitness does improve is everything else — a lower resting heart rate, a stronger heart that pumps more blood per beat, and the ability to work at a higher percentage of your maximum comfortably.
Do beta-blockers lower maximum heart rate?
Yes. Beta-blockers and some other medicines slow the heart and lower both resting and maximum heart rate, so the 220-minus-age estimate will be too high if you take them. If you are on medicines that affect your heart rate, ask your doctor what maximum and target heart rate are appropriate for you rather than relying on the formula.
